Jul 29, 2022 11:31 | #16573 There's a bigger difference in image quality between the 70d and 80d - if you're doing a lot of lower light/cloud day work in that 400-1600 ISO range, it's a solid 2/3rds of a stop upgrade. The 90d is maybe another 1/3rd from there with more resolution, but, much much much much much pickier when it comes to lens selection/technique/proper exposure.
